In society today people face many of threats to their safety and well being. Chances are, the more money or power a person has the greater the threat of violence or kidnapping. In an effort to mitigate the danger, those who can afford it will obtain executive protection services.

These services can take several forms and often vary according to the height of the danger observed. An executive may receive twenty five or thirty threatening emails a week in the office as a norm but if a letter is slipped under his door at home the problem escalates in intensity. The security team must then take extra caution while protecting him and his family.

The personnel who guard your safety during your daily activities are required to remain professional. They can suffer breaches in objectivity if they become too friendly with your family or business. They may lower their guard and allow a dangerous situation, causing harm to the principal client or his family. An attitude of strict professionalism is the best answer.

The routes of travel taken on a daily basis could also be viewed as a potential area of danger. The team you work with should be responsible for taking this into consideration and plotting varied routes and times of departure. Business trips out of city call for varied steps such as multiple air lines used, different hotels booked and vehicle rental security.

When considering security the options may include setting up alarm systems, panic alarm systems or bolt rooms where principals and their families can safely await rescue by police or personal security agencies. Many companies in targeted fields, such as finance or pharmaceutical industries provide the security systems for their upper level personnel. The protection is considered a necessity to insure the safety of anyone involved with their company. There are standards of protection set for each industry that can help determining the needed level of protection.

High profile people are especially difficult to protect. They create circumstances that must be handled with utmost skill and tact. The agents must be able to blend into their surroundings while maintaining a safe atmosphere for their client. Strong arm tactics are not an option for the professional working with important personnel.

The standard for a protection professional includes a person who is educated, trainable, respectful and dedicated. They must know how to blend into their environment and carry on an intelligent conversation. They understand that they represent the executive and his company. Many companies hire retired police, soldiers or secret service agents to fill the role. Qualified individuals can also be recruited from employees already on payroll. The physical skills can be taught but the dedication, discretion and integrity are harder to find.

The CSO has the job of identifying promising security professionals. He must mentor them and give them the training necessary to provide effective executive protection services. The training can include skills pertaining to recognizing the threat of attack and how to deal with it, how to blend in when accompanying the principal client. It may also contain alarm systems and their control systems, familiarity with armored vehicles and fire arms.
